F. President Eli Capilouto — Perspective on University’s Current Status
President Capilouto presented another PowerPoint presentation regarding a summary of
what he leamed from meeting with Board members, faculty, staff; students, donors, and
legislators. He talked about the legislative climate and said that the state is committed to having
more Kentuckians with college degrees. The Board had a very lengthy discussion about the
legislative climate and offered suggestions about improving the relationship and work between
the legislators and the University. Mr. Mobley pointed out that the University has a plan in place
and said that the University needed to activate the program and the process to do it.
